WHAT HAPPENED

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has formally rejected a U.S.-backed Gaza peace plan that proposes Israeli withdrawal once Hamas is fully disarmed. In a public statement, he said Israel would not leave Gaza until Hamas completely disarms, putting him at odds with the Trump‑endorsed roadmap.

The plan, a 15‑point roadmap championed by former President Donald Trump, calls for phased Israeli withdrawal from Gaza in exchange for a full Hamas disarmament. According to Deutsche Welle, Netanyahu’s refusal signals a break with Trump’s proposal and a continuation of the status‑quo policy in Gaza.

The rejection follows ongoing hostilities between Israel and Hamas, with both sides entrenched over security and territorial issues that have fueled repeated flare‑ups in the Gaza Strip.

  • Netanyahu rejects the U.S./Trump‑backed 15‑point Gaza peace plan.
  • Plan calls for Israel to withdraw once Hamas fully disarms.
  • Netanyahu’s statement confirms Israel will stay in Gaza until disarmament is complete.
